## Project Overview
`cor` is a Rust CLI tool that colorizes JSON-structured log lines from stdin. It auto-detects timestamp/level/message fields across logging frameworks (logrus, zap, slog, pino, bunyan, structlog) and outputs colorized human-readable text. Non-JSON lines pass through unchanged.
- **Language:** Rust (edition 2024, MSRV 1.92)
- **Binary:** `cor`
- **Crate:** `cor` on crates.io

## Architecture
| `src/main.rs` | CLI entry point, stdin/stdout I/O loop, multi-line JSON reassembly |
| `src/cli.rs` | Clap argument definitions |
| `src/config.rs` | Configuration merging: defaults → TOML file (`~/.config/cor/config.toml`) → CLI flags |
| `src/parser.rs` | JSON log line parser with auto-detection and embedded JSON support |
| `src/formatter.rs` | Colorized output formatter |
| `src/level.rs` | Log level enum with parsing, display, colorization, and numeric level support |
| `src/timestamp.rs` | Timestamp parsing and formatting |
| `src/fields.rs` | Field alias tables for auto-detecting common log fields |
| `src/error.rs` | Error types using `thiserror` |
### Key Data Flow
1. **Input:** Lines read from stdin
2. **Parsing:** `parser::parse_line()` returns `LineKind` (JSON/EmbeddedJSON/Raw)
3. **Filtering:** Level filtering applied via `Config`
4. **Formatting:** `formatter::format_line_parsed()` produces colorized output
5. **Output:** Written to stdout with configurable line gap
### Multi-line JSON Handling
The main loop in `main.rs` handles JSON with embedded newlines by buffering up to 200 continuation lines and using `sanitize_json_newlines()` to reassemble them.
